Latest Patents

Alina holds a patent for her groundbreaking work titled "Oligomerisation with Indium (III) Chloride." This patent discloses novel processes for the oligomerization of unsaturated hydrocarbons. Specifically, it focuses on the use of selected ionic liquids containing Indium (III) Chloride, which allows for the selection of the oligomers formed.
